  • Publication number: 20240117020
    Abstract: In one embodiment, the present disclosure provides a combination of recombinant Ara h 1 and Ara h 2 variant polypeptides lacking at least one epitope recognized by anti-Ara h 1 antibodies and anti-Ara h 2 antibodies, respectively, thereby having reduced or abolished antibody binding to the peanut allergen. These peanut allergen variants may be used in methods of treating subjects allergic to peanuts and reducing the severity of their allergy.
